Output ef8dd01f5648cb4978ef87bf228285db2a519ebe18110cddb1607eee615aa3e4:1

value
676968280
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 44dd013a97d8de74284c67e4fbb9e02423bdc5f5 OP_EQUALVERIFY OP_CHECKSIG
address
17H7hjBHvW8n34PC4ZASKBtEKzjrt79VGz
transaction
ef8dd01f5648cb4978ef87bf228285db2a519ebe18110cddb1607eee615aa3e4
spent
true